苯系物是衡量水质的重要指标之一,是水环境监测优先管控的主要污染物。生活饮用水,尤其水源地水中通常并不希望检出苯系物,这些水体中苯系物的含量一般不高,浓度在方法检出限附近。因此分析过程所用试剂,尤其是标样配制必不可少的甲醇... 苯系物是衡量水质的重要指标之一,是水环境监测优先管控的主要污染物。生活饮用水,尤其水源地水中通常并不希望检出苯系物,这些水体中苯系物的含量一般不高,浓度在方法检出限附近。因此分析过程所用试剂,尤其是标样配制必不可少的甲醇中是否存在苯系物杂质,存在情况如何,对水中低浓度苯系物的准确测定非常关键。吹扫捕集-气相色谱-质谱联用法(P&T-GC-MS)具有较好的分离度和灵敏度,且进样量少、干扰小,是水中痕量苯系物检测的优选方法。本研究基于P&T-GC-MS法,开展甲醇试剂的苯系物本底研究,探索实验室常用甲醇试剂中的苯系物杂质对定量结果的影响程度和影响规律,为环境监测相关工作和研究提供数据支持。 展开更多

Analysis of long term catalytic performance for isobutane alkylation catalyzed by NMA–AlCl3 based ionic liquid analog 被引量:3

Isobutane alkylation with 2-butene to produce high-quality gasoline was catalyzed by Nmethylacetamide(NMA)-AlCl3 based ionic liquid(IL) analog with a NMA/AlCl3 molar ratio of 0.75 and CuCl modification,which was marked as CuCl-modified 0.75 NMA-1.0 AlCl3.The long-term experiment was carried out in the autoclave operated in continuous mode to investigate the distribution of alkylate under different experimental nodes.The result indicated that the long-term alkylation was divided into three stages:rising,stable,and descending regions.C8 selectivity and molar ratio of trimethylpentanes(TMPs) to dimethylhexanes(DMHs) reached the highest level in the stable region,and research octane number(RON) of alkylate was as high as 97.Anionic Al species([AlbCl7]^-,[A1 CuC15]^-) and cationic Al species([AlCl2 L]^+) from IL analog as two active Lewis acidic species played a catalytic role in the long-term alkylation,whereas the neutral Al species did not participate into the alkylation.Moreover,the structure of CuCl-modified 0.75 NMA-1.0 AlCl3 was destroyed after the deactivation,and CuCl was enriched in the CD2 Cl2-insoluble substance,resulting in a decreasing TMP/DMH ratio.The catalytic lifetime of IL analog was similar with CuCl-modified 0.55 Et3 NHCl-1.0 AlCl3 IL,but IL analog had a lower cost. 展开更多

A patent is a kind of technical document to protect intellectual property for individuals or enterprises. Patentable idea generation is a crucial step for patent application and analogy is confirmed to be an effective technique to inspire creative ideas. Analogy?based design usually starts from representation of an analogy source and is followed by the retrieval of appropriate analogs, mapping of design knowledge and adaptation of target solution. To diffuse one core idea into other new contexts and achieve more patentable ideas, this paper mainly centered on the first two stages of analogy?based design and proposed a patentable ideation framework. The analogical information of the source system, including source design problems and solution, was mined comprehensively through International Patent Classification analysis and represented in the form of function, behavior and structure. Three heuristics were suggested for searching the set of candidate target systems with a similar design problem, where the source design could be transferred. To systematize the process of source representation, analogs retrieval, idea transfer, and solution generation, an ideation model was put forward. Finally, the bladeless fan was selected as a source design to illustrate the application of this work. The design output shows that the representation and heuristics are beneficial, and this systematic ideation method can help the engineer or designer enhance creativity and discover more patentable opportunities. 展开更多

Diseases caused by fungal pathogens account for approximately 50% of all soybean disease losses around the world. Conflicting results of fungal disease resistance QTLs from different populations often occurred. The objectives of this study were to: (i) evaluate evidence for reported fungal disease resistance QTLs associations in soybean and (ii) extract relatively reliable and useful information from the "real" QTLs and mine putative genes in soybean. An integrated map of fungal disease resistance QTLs in soybean was established with soymap 2 published in 2004 as a reference map. QTLs of fungal disease resistance developed from each of separate populations in recent 10 years were integrated into a combinative map for gene cloning and marker assisted selection in soybean. 107 QTLs from different maps were integrated and projected to the reference map with the software BioMercator 2.1. A method of meta-analysis was used to narrow down the confidence interval, and 23 "real" QTLs and their corresponding markers were obtained from 12 linkage groups (LG), respectively. Two published R genes were found in these "real" QTLs intervals. Sequences in the "real" QTLs intervals were predicted by GENSCAN, and these predicted genes were annotated in Goblet. 228 resistance gene analogs (RGAs) in 12 different terms were mined. The results will lay the foundation for a bioinformatics platform combining abundant QTLs, and offer the basis for marker assisted selection and gene cloning in soybean. 展开更多

In this work a method called “signal flow graph (SFG)” is presented. A signal-flow graph describes a system by its signal flow by directed and weighted graph;the signals are applied to nodes and functions on edges. The edges of the signal flow graph are small processing units, through which the incoming signals are processed in a certain form. In this case, the result is sent to the outgoing node. The SFG allows a good visual inspection into complex feedback problems. Furthermore such a presentation allows for a clear and unambiguous description of a generating system, for example, a netview. A Signal Flow Graph (SFG) allows a fast and practical network analysis based on a clear data presentation in graphic format of the mathematical linear equations of the circuit. During creation of a SFG the Direct Current-Case (DC-Case) was observed since the correct current and voltage directions was drawn from zero frequency. In addition, the mathematical axioms, which are based on field algebra, are declared. In this work we show you in addition: How we check our SFG whether it is a consistent system or not. A signal flow graph can be verified by generating the identity of the signal flow graph itself, illustrated by the inverse signal flow graph (SFG&minus;1). Two signal flow graphs are always generated from one circuit, so that the signal flow diagram already presented in previous sections corresponds to only half of the solution. The other half of the solution is the so-called identity, which represents the (SFG&minus;1). If these two graphs are superposed with one another, so called 1-edges are created at the node points. In Boolean algebra, these 1-edges are given the value 1, whereas this value can be identified with a zero in the field algebra. 展开更多

A common current source, generally used to bias cross-coupled differential amplifiers in a transconductor, controls third harmonic distortion (HD3) poorly. Separate current sources are shown to provide better control on HD3) . In this paper, a detailed design and analysis is presented for a transconductor made using this biasing technique. The transconductor, in addition, is made to offer high Gm, low power dissipation and is designed for linearly tunable Gm with current mode load as one of the applications. The circuit exhibits HD3) of less than –43.7 dB, high current efficiency of 1.18 V-1 and Gm of 390 μS at 1 VGp-p @ 50 MHz. UMC 0.18 μm CMOS process technology is used for simulation at supply voltage of 1.8 V. 展开更多

Symbolic analysis has many applications in the design of analog circuits. Existing approaches rely on two forms of symbolic-expression representation: expanded sum-of-product form and arbitrarily nested form. Expanded form suffers the problem that the number of product terms grows exponentially with the size of a circuit. Nested form is neither canonical nor amenable to symbolic manipulation. In this paper, we present a new approach to exact and canonical symbolic analysis by exploiting the sparsity and sharing of product terms. This algorithm, called totally coded method (TCM), consists of representing the symbolic determinant of a circuit matrix by code series and performing symbolic analysis by code manipulation. We describe an efficient code-ordering heuristic and prove that it is optimum for ladder-structured circuits. For practical analog circuits, TCM not only covers all advantages of the algorithm via determinant decision diagrams (DDD) but is more simple and efficient than DDD method. 展开更多

针对模拟电路故障诊断中非线性和高维度输出信号带来的诊断困难问题,提出一种基于改进鲸鱼算法(IWOA)优化极限学习机(ELM)的模拟电路故障诊断方法。首先,采用主成分分析(PCA)法对初始故障电路特征进行降维;其次,在鲸鱼算法的基础上引入T... 针对模拟电路故障诊断中非线性和高维度输出信号带来的诊断困难问题,提出一种基于改进鲸鱼算法(IWOA)优化极限学习机(ELM)的模拟电路故障诊断方法。首先,采用主成分分析(PCA)法对初始故障电路特征进行降维;其次,在鲸鱼算法的基础上引入Tent映射来初始化种群,并且加入了非线性时变因子、自适应权重以及随机差分变异策略;再利用改进后的鲸鱼算法对ELM进行优化;最后将降维后的故障特征向量输入ELM中得到故障诊断结果。通过Sallen-Key带通滤波器电路以及CSTV滤波器电路仿真测试实例表明:IWOA优化ELM的故障诊断方法具有更优的故障诊断性能,故障诊断准确率高达99.41%。 展开更多

为降低光伏功率预测中预报总辐射误差且探讨各类订正方法的适用性,分季节对比分析逐步回归、支持向量机(SVM)和相似误差订正(AnBC)方法对快速更新多尺度分析和预报系统短期预报总辐射的订正效果.结果表明,订正后明显降低了预报误差,一... 为降低光伏功率预测中预报总辐射误差且探讨各类订正方法的适用性,分季节对比分析逐步回归、支持向量机(SVM)和相似误差订正(AnBC)方法对快速更新多尺度分析和预报系统短期预报总辐射的订正效果.结果表明,订正后明显降低了预报误差,一定程度上改善了预报总辐射分布较分散和偏大的情况.酒泉鸿坤光伏电站秋季逐步回归订正效果相对最佳(平均绝对偏差(M_(AE))降低4.56 W/m^(2)),冬季、夏季和春季均是AnBC效果相对最佳(M_(AE)依次降低10.33、12.71、44.27 W/m^(2));敦煌电建汇能光伏电站秋季和冬季均是SVM订正效果相对最佳(M_(AE)分别降低4.73和7.85 W/m^(2)),夏季和春季均是AnBC效果相对最佳(M_(AE)分别降低16.24和34.17 W/m^(2)).两座电站逐小时误差分布显示AnBC效果相对最佳;就各季节相对最佳订正方法而言,订正后春季提高时次百分比最高(酒泉鸿坤为73.88%,电建汇能为77.28%).晴天SVM订正效果最明显,非晴天AnBC效果最明显. 展开更多

市域(郊)铁路桥梁占比大,但行业内尚无统一的桥梁建设标准。项目前期研究冗繁,差异大,标准化、科学化水平有待提高。本文以苏虞张线(苏州—常熟—张家港)为例,从结构体系、梁跨选择、下部结构设计等方面,对标准跨度桥梁进行初步研究。... 市域(郊)铁路桥梁占比大,但行业内尚无统一的桥梁建设标准。项目前期研究冗繁,差异大,标准化、科学化水平有待提高。本文以苏虞张线(苏州—常熟—张家港)为例,从结构体系、梁跨选择、下部结构设计等方面,对标准跨度桥梁进行初步研究。结果表明:能适应梁场整孔预制、架桥机架设工法的标准跨度简支梁,是市域(郊)铁路桥梁选择的方向;双线大箱梁为市域(郊)铁路优选梁型;35 m为市域(郊)铁路标准桥梁的最优跨径;35 m梁设计可采用薄腹板、大型号钢束,结构尺寸较优。桥墩纵向尺寸可以优化,高度10 m及以下的桥墩,纵向尺寸可减小至1.2 m,全桥动力性能满足规范要求。打入桩最经济,但受限条件多;预钻根植桩和后压浆桩受压浆质量难以检测或判断影响,可以少量试验应用;常规钻孔灌注桩仍是市域(郊)铁路桥梁主要采用的桩基形式。 展开更多

在光伏电站建设前期做可行性评估的过程中,需要对拟建光伏电站的发电量进行理论上的预测,以此来测算项目的投资收益率,进而评估项目是否值得投资建设。光伏电站发电能力评估的准确性受限于气象数据的准确性及光伏电站系统效率(PR)评估... 在光伏电站建设前期做可行性评估的过程中,需要对拟建光伏电站的发电量进行理论上的预测,以此来测算项目的投资收益率,进而评估项目是否值得投资建设。光伏电站发电能力评估的准确性受限于气象数据的准确性及光伏电站系统效率(PR)评估的准确性。由于环境复杂性高、实际测量难度大等原因,导致无法获得拟建光伏电站真实的气象数据及准确的PR。将拟建光伏电站周边的光伏电站作为参考,引入参考光伏电站的历史发电数据,结合参考光伏电站与拟建光伏电站的太阳辐射量差异、PR差异,提出了一种基于类比分析法的光伏电站发电能力评估模型。通过建立评估模型,解耦气象因素偏差对光伏电站PR的影响,分析各因素导致的评估模型的偏差范围,并采用3组光伏电站对照组的发电数据对评估模型的准确性进行了验证。研究结果表明:气象因素偏差对光伏电站PR的最大影响为1.5972%。采用该评估模型测算得到的3组光伏电站对照组的年等效利用小时数评估偏差皆控制在3.00%以内,平均偏差为1.21%,远低于采用PVsyst软件测算得到的年等效利用小时数的平均偏差。表明该评估模型具有良好地准确度,可作为光伏电站建设时评估其发电量的实用且有效的方法。 展开更多
